Review of 2022 Kawasaki Ninja H2 SX SE

The 2022 Kawasaki Ninja H2 SX SE stands out as a remarkable sport-touring motorcycle that seamlessly blends performance with luxury. With its supercharged 998cc inline-four engine, riders can expect exhilarating power and torque, delivering a thrilling ride whether on highways or winding back roads. The advanced electronics suite, including Kawasaki's Intelligent Anti-lock Brake System (KIBS) and cornering management functions, enhances safety and stability, making it accessible for both seasoned riders and newcomers alike. Furthermore, the addition of a high-resolution TFT display and smartphone connectivity elevates the riding experience, allowing for navigation and media control at the fingertips. In terms of value, the Ninja H2 SX SE is a compelling choice for those seeking a versatile motorcycle that doesn't compromise on performance or comfort. Its plush, adjustable suspension and comfortable ergonomics make long-distance travel enjoyable, while the aerodynamic design contributes to both performance and fuel efficiency. Advantages

  • Powerful Performance: The 998cc supercharged inline-four engine delivers exhilarating power and torque, making it one of the most performance-oriented sport-touring bikes in its class.
  • Advanced Technology: Equipped with a host of modern electronics, including multiple riding modes, traction control, and cornering ABS, the H2 SX SE offers enhanced safety and adaptability for various riding conditions.
  • Comfortable Ergonomics: Designed with sport-touring in mind, the bike features a more relaxed riding position, plush seat, and adjustable windscreen, making long-distance rides more enjoyable.
  • High-Quality Suspension: The bike comes with a premium suspension setup, including fully adjustable Showa forks and a rear shock, providing excellent handling and stability on both twisty roads and highways.
  • Touring Features: With standard features like a large fuel tank for extended range, integrated saddlebags, and a vibrant TFT display with smartphone connectivity, the H2 SX SE is well-suited for touring enthusiasts who crave performance.

Disadvantages

  • High Price Point: The H2 SX SE comes with a premium price tag, making it less accessible for many riders compared to other sport-touring motorcycles.
  • Weight: Being a heavier bike, the H2 SX SE may be less maneuverable in tight situations, which can be a drawback for riders who prefer a more agile handling experience.
  • Comfort on Long Rides: While it is designed for sport-touring, some riders may find the seat and riding position less comfortable for extended journeys compared to dedicated touring bikes.
  • Complex Electronics: The advanced electronic systems, while beneficial, can be overwhelming for some riders, especially those who prefer a more straightforward riding experience without extensive tech.
  • Fuel Economy: The powerful supercharged engine, while thrilling, may lead to lower fuel efficiency compared to other touring bikes, resulting in more frequent stops for fuel on long trips.

Alternatives

  • BMW K1600GT The BMW K1600GT is a sport-touring motorcycle that excels in long-distance comfort and performance. Featuring a powerful 1649cc inline-six engine, it delivers smooth power and torque. The K1600GT is equipped with advanced technology, including dynamic traction control, ABS, and a full suite of rider aids, making it both a comfortable cruiser and a capable sportbike.
  • Ducati Multistrada V4 S The Ducati Multistrada V4 S is a versatile adventure touring bike that combines sporty performance with long-distance capabilities. It is powered by a 1158cc V4 engine that offers exhilarating acceleration and handling. With advanced electronics, adaptive cruise control, and multiple riding modes, it is designed for both on-road and light off-road adventures, making it a great all-rounder.
  • Honda Gold Wing The Honda Gold Wing is a legendary touring motorcycle known for its comfort and long-range capabilities. It features a horizontally opposed 1833cc six-cylinder engine that provides smooth power delivery. With premium amenities such as a plush seat, a high-quality audio system, and extensive storage options, the Gold Wing is perfect for riders who prioritize comfort on long journeys.
  • Yamaha FJR1300 The Yamaha FJR1300 is a sport-touring motorcycle that balances performance with comfort. Powered by a 1298cc inline-four engine, it offers strong acceleration and a responsive ride. The FJR1300 features an adjustable windscreen, heated grips, and a comfortable riding position, making it ideal for long-distance travel while still providing a sporty edge.
  • Suzuki GSX-S1000GT The Suzuki GSX-S1000GT is a sport-touring motorcycle that blends performance with everyday usability. It is powered by a 999cc inline-four engine derived from the GSX-R series, providing thrilling performance. With a comfortable riding position, electronic aids like traction control and ride modes, and integrated luggage options, it's designed for both spirited rides and longer journeys.
